Call for more help for older autistic people after review finds many still undiagnosed

Researchers have called for better support for middle-aged and older autistic people after a review found that 90% of over-50s in Britain are either undiagnosed or misdiagnosed.
Greater awareness of autism and improved assessments globally mean it is typically spotted in childhood today. But in past decades autistic people were often forced to navigate middle and old age without the support a diagnosis can unlock.
The review into ageing across the autism spectrum found that people in the UK faced widespread difficulties with employment, relationships and milestone events such as menopause and retirement. They consistently suffered from poorer mental and physical health.
"Autistic children grow into autistic adults and we know that they are more likely to have higher rates of most physical and mental health problems," said Dr Gavin Stewart, co-lead of the ReSpect Lab at King's College London and lead author of the review. "People often need a diagnosis, or need to recognise it within themselves, to be able to ask for appropriate help and support."
